KIMS, Dept of Respiratory Medicine Hosts STF Quarterly Meet

New Delhi: The quarterly gathering of the State Task Force (STF) under the National TB Elimination Programme (NTEP) took place at the Department of Respiratory Medicine, Kalinga Institute of Medical Sciences (KIMS) on August 4, 2023. The meeting was held in a hybrid mode convening to discuss crucial matters. 

Distinguished attendees of the meeting included Prof Manoranjan Patnaik, serving as the Chairman of STF, Prof Sudarshan Pothal, Vice-Chairman of STF, and Dr PK Hota, State TB Officer (STO). 

The meeting held at KIMS commenced with a warm welcome from Chairman Prof Sudarshan Pothal, who proceeded to highlight the significance of the STF's role along with the contributions of various medical colleges towards the noble goal of eradicating TB.

The primary objective of the STF revolves around ensuring the effective implementation of the National TB Elimination Programme (NTEP) across diverse medical colleges within the state. An overview of the performance exhibited by all the state's medical colleges was presented, followed by a comprehensive examination of their strengths and areas requiring improvement. 

Dr Saswat Subhankar, the Nodal Officer for NTEP, presented KIMS's performance report during the meeting.

Moreover, the STF plays a pivotal role in extending financial support for projects that align with the program's objectives. Within this context, two operational research papers originating from SCBMCH were showcased during the meeting, underscoring the commitment to fostering research-driven advancements. 

As the meeting came to an end, Prof Pratima Singh, Head of the Department of Respiratory Medicine at KIMS, extended a vote of gratitude on behalf of the attendees.
